The Birth of MP3

The MP3 format was born in the late 1980s and early 1990s as researchers sought a way to compress audio files without significantly compromising sound quality. The breakthrough came with the development of the MP3 codec, which allowed for high levels of compression while retaining much of the original audio fidelity. This made it possible to store and transmit music files over the internet with relative ease, opening up new possibilities for digital music distribution.

The Rise of Napster and Peer-to-Peer Sharing

One of the key moments in the history of MP3 downloads came with the rise of Napster in the late 1990s. Napster, a peer-to-peer file-sharing service, allowed users to easily share MP3 files with each other over the internet. This led to a surge in the popularity of MP3 downloads, as users could now access a vast library of music from their own homes.

The Impact on the Music Industry

The rise of MP3 downloads had a profound impact on the music industry, disrupting traditional distribution models and challenging the dominance of physical formats like CDs. As MP3 downloads became more popular, sales of CDs began to decline, leading to a major shift in the way music was consumed.

The Transition to Legal Downloads

While the early days of MP3 downloads were marked by controversy and legal battles, the music industry eventually began to embrace digital distribution. Services like iTunes and later, Spotify, offered legal ways to download and stream music, providing artists and record labels with new revenue streams.
